Village Overview

Dhapewada Kh. is a village in Kalameshwar Taluka, also recorded as a Census sub-district, Nagpur district, Maharashtra. For Dhapewada Kh., the population is 1,730 and Census village code is 535156. Location and Administration

Dhapewada Kh. comes under Dhapewada Kh. gram panchayat and Kalameshwar C.D. Block. Its local administrative unit is Kalameshwar Taluka, also recorded as a Census sub-district. The taluka headquarters is Kalameshwar at 9 km. The Census district headquarters, Nagpur, is 34 km away.

Agriculture and Land Use

Land-use area is reported in hectares using Census village directory land-use categories such as net area sown, irrigated area, forest, fallow land and non-agricultural use. This is useful for general village research, farming context and local area study.

Agriculture and land-use records for Dhapewada Kh.
Net area sown340.20 hectares
Irrigated area301.30 hectares
Unirrigated area38.90 hectares
Wells / tube wells irrigated area38.90 hectares
Forest area17.79 hectares
Non-agricultural area32.70 hectares
Main cropSoybean
Second cropCotton
Third cropJowar
